com.atlassian.theplugin.commons.remoteapi.RemoteApiException: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d

Atlassian JIRA | Jeff Turner (Unused account) | 7 years ago
tip
Click on the to mark the solution that helps you, Samebug will learn from it.
As a community member, you’ll be rewarded for you help.
  1. 0

    In the IntelliJ IDEA Atlassian connector, submitting a pre-commit code review triggers a stacktrace: com.atlassian.theplugin.commons.remoteapi.RemoteApiException: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d at com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.buildExceptionText(AbstractHttpSession.java:487) at com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.retrievePostResponse(AbstractHttpSession.java:430) at com.atlassian.theplugin.commons.crucible.api.rest.CrucibleSessionImpl.createReviewFromUpload(CrucibleSessionImpl.java:1253) at com.atlassian.theplugin.commons.crucible.CrucibleServerFacadeImpl.createReviewFromUpload(CrucibleServerFacadeImpl.java:143) at com.atlassian.connector.intellij.crucible.IntelliJCrucibleServerFacade.createReviewFromUpload(IntelliJCrucibleServerFacade.java:130) at com.atlassian.theplugin.idea.crucible.AbstractCrucibleCreatePreCommitReviewForm.createReviewImpl(AbstractCrucibleCreatePreCommitReviewForm.java:56) at com.atlassian.theplugin.idea.crucible.CrucibleCreatePreCommitUploadReviewForm.createReview(CrucibleCreatePreCommitUploadReviewForm.java:60) at com.atlassian.theplugin.idea.crucible.CrucibleReviewCreateForm$8.run(CrucibleReviewCreateForm.java:811) at com.intellij.openapi.progress.impl.ProgressManagerImpl$TaskRunnable.run(ProgressManagerImpl.java:3) at com.intellij.openapi.progress.impl.ProgressManagerImpl$2.run(ProgressManagerImpl.java:5) at com.intellij.openapi.progress.impl.ProgressManagerImpl.executeProcessUnderProgress(ProgressManagerImpl.java:13) at com.intellij.openapi.progress.impl.ProgressManagerImpl.runProcess(ProgressManagerImpl.java:101) at com.intellij.openapi.progress.impl.ProgressManagerImpl$6.run(ProgressManagerImpl.java:16) at com.intellij.openapi.application.impl.ApplicationImpl$5.run(ApplicationImpl.java:8) at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:441) at java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:303) at java.util.concurrent.FutureTask.run(FutureTask.java:138) at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:886) at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:908) at java.lang.Thread.run(Thread.java:619) at com.intellij.openapi.application.impl.ApplicationImpl$1$1.run(ApplicationImpl.java:5)

    Atlassian JIRA | 7 years ago | Jeff Turner
    com.atlassian.theplugin.commons.remoteapi.RemoteApiException: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d
  2. 0

    In the IntelliJ IDEA Atlassian connector, submitting a pre-commit code review triggers a stacktrace: com.atlassian.theplugin.commons.remoteapi.RemoteApiException: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d at com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.buildExceptionText(AbstractHttpSession.java:487) at com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.retrievePostResponse(AbstractHttpSession.java:430) at com.atlassian.theplugin.commons.crucible.api.rest.CrucibleSessionImpl.createReviewFromUpload(CrucibleSessionImpl.java:1253) at com.atlassian.theplugin.commons.crucible.CrucibleServerFacadeImpl.createReviewFromUpload(CrucibleServerFacadeImpl.java:143) at com.atlassian.connector.intellij.crucible.IntelliJCrucibleServerFacade.createReviewFromUpload(IntelliJCrucibleServerFacade.java:130) at com.atlassian.theplugin.idea.crucible.AbstractCrucibleCreatePreCommitReviewForm.createReviewImpl(AbstractCrucibleCreatePreCommitReviewForm.java:56) at com.atlassian.theplugin.idea.crucible.CrucibleCreatePreCommitUploadReviewForm.createReview(CrucibleCreatePreCommitUploadReviewForm.java:60) at com.atlassian.theplugin.idea.crucible.CrucibleReviewCreateForm$8.run(CrucibleReviewCreateForm.java:811) at com.intellij.openapi.progress.impl.ProgressManagerImpl$TaskRunnable.run(ProgressManagerImpl.java:3) at com.intellij.openapi.progress.impl.ProgressManagerImpl$2.run(ProgressManagerImpl.java:5) at com.intellij.openapi.progress.impl.ProgressManagerImpl.executeProcessUnderProgress(ProgressManagerImpl.java:13) at com.intellij.openapi.progress.impl.ProgressManagerImpl.runProcess(ProgressManagerImpl.java:101) at com.intellij.openapi.progress.impl.ProgressManagerImpl$6.run(ProgressManagerImpl.java:16) at com.intellij.openapi.application.impl.ApplicationImpl$5.run(ApplicationImpl.java:8) at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:441) at java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:303) at java.util.concurrent.FutureTask.run(FutureTask.java:138) at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:886) at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:908) at java.lang.Thread.run(Thread.java:619) at com.intellij.openapi.application.impl.ApplicationImpl$1$1.run(ApplicationImpl.java:5)

    Atlassian JIRA | 7 years ago | Jeff Turner (Unused account)
    com.atlassian.theplugin.commons.remoteapi.RemoteApiException: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d

    Root Cause Analysis

    1. com.atlassian.theplugin.commons.remoteapi.RemoteApiException

      Server returned HTTP 403 (Forbidden) Reason: NotPermitted Message: You do not have permission to Edit Review Details the review CR-TEST-123: com.cenqua.crucible.model.Review@27d

      at com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.buildExceptionText()
    2. com.atlassian.theplugin
      CrucibleServerFacadeImpl.createReviewFromUpload
      1. com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.buildExceptionText(AbstractHttpSession.java:487)
      2. com.atlassian.theplugin.commons.remoteapi.rest.AbstractHttpSession.retrievePostResponse(AbstractHttpSession.java:430)
      3. com.atlassian.theplugin.commons.crucible.api.rest.CrucibleSessionImpl.createReviewFromUpload(CrucibleSessionImpl.java:1253)
      4. com.atlassian.theplugin.commons.crucible.CrucibleServerFacadeImpl.createReviewFromUpload(CrucibleServerFacadeImpl.java:143)
      4 frames
    3. com.atlassian.connector
      IntelliJCrucibleServerFacade.createReviewFromUpload
      1. com.atlassian.connector.intellij.crucible.IntelliJCrucibleServerFacade.createReviewFromUpload(IntelliJCrucibleServerFacade.java:130)
      1 frame
    4. com.atlassian.theplugin
      CrucibleReviewCreateForm$8.run
      1. com.atlassian.theplugin.idea.crucible.AbstractCrucibleCreatePreCommitReviewForm.createReviewImpl(AbstractCrucibleCreatePreCommitReviewForm.java:56)
      2. com.atlassian.theplugin.idea.crucible.CrucibleCreatePreCommitUploadReviewForm.createReview(CrucibleCreatePreCommitUploadReviewForm.java:60)
      3. com.atlassian.theplugin.idea.crucible.CrucibleReviewCreateForm$8.run(CrucibleReviewCreateForm.java:811)
      3 frames
    5. IDEA
      ApplicationImpl$5.run
      1. com.intellij.openapi.progress.impl.ProgressManagerImpl$TaskRunnable.run(ProgressManagerImpl.java:3)
      2. com.intellij.openapi.progress.impl.ProgressManagerImpl$2.run(ProgressManagerImpl.java:5)
      3. com.intellij.openapi.progress.impl.ProgressManagerImpl.executeProcessUnderProgress(ProgressManagerImpl.java:13)
      4. com.intellij.openapi.progress.impl.ProgressManagerImpl.runProcess(ProgressManagerImpl.java:101)
      5. com.intellij.openapi.progress.impl.ProgressManagerImpl$6.run(ProgressManagerImpl.java:16)
      6. com.intellij.openapi.application.impl.ApplicationImpl$5.run(ApplicationImpl.java:8)
      6 frames
    6. Java RT
      Thread.run
      1. java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:441)
      2. java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:303)
      3. java.util.concurrent.FutureTask.run(FutureTask.java:138)
      4. java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:886)
      5. java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:908)
      6. java.lang.Thread.run(Thread.java:619)
      6 frames
    7. IDEA
      ApplicationImpl$1$1.run
      1. com.intellij.openapi.application.impl.ApplicationImpl$1$1.run(ApplicationImpl.java:5)
      1 frame